This engineer works within or on the test and reliability team and/or a project team, generally within the molecular R&D project group. This engineer will use experience and education to test and evaluate electromechanical medical devices to identify product limits and to identify and evaluate improvements throughout the products lifecycle. This engineer uses experience and education to perform the types of engineering activities which are generally considered within the realm of test and reliability engineering and any other expertise that might be held by this particular individual. This engineer is expected to work and communicate well with other team members and leadership as assigned in order to meet the goals of the project, the department, and the company.Principal Job Duties and Responsibilities include but are not limited to the following:1. Perform all work in compliance with company policy and within the guidelines of *** Quality System.2. General: uses experience and education to perform the types of engineering activities which are generally considered within the realm of test and reliability engineering.3. Description: Uses engineering concepts, company SOPs/WIDs, department SOPs/WIDs to solve a variety of difficult engineering problems across functional groups and disciplines.4. Works on: problems of moderate scope and complexity. Generally works on a team with other engineers.5. Influence: receives some oversight from a Senior/Principal Engineer and/or Manager, eligible to be a discipline lead on a project.6. Makes design and technical decisions subject to review by Senior, Principal, and other engineers.7. Perform Root cause analysis on failures observed during testing.8. Participate in and conduct Engineering product design reviews and investigations9. Responsible for development of testing for electromechanical medical device throughout its product life cycle, including:a. Environmental testing (Temperature, Humidity, Altitude)b. Shock and vibration testingc. Reliability testingd. Ship testinge. Dust ingressf. Water ingressg. Electrical/EMC/EMI10. Developing Test Fixture Designs.11. Develop and maintain test protocols and test plans throughout the development cycle (utilizing Helix ALM) for electrical and mechanical sub level testing and electromechanical system level testing.a. Design Verification Testingb. Design Validation Testing.12. Performs other duties as assigned.Qualifications:13. B.S. in Engineering or Equivalent.14. 10+ years of experience in an engineering field, testing field preferred.
